About this opportunity:
We are seeking a highly motivated and skilled RAN & Core Performance Engineer to join our telecom network team. The candidate will be responsible for Performance KPI’s, assurance, troubleshooting, and optimization of both Radio Access Networks and Core Network (CS/PS/VAS) components. This role requires in-depth technical knowledge of mobile technologies (2G/3G/4G/5G/ NBIoT), Core, network architecture, and protocols, etc.
What you will do:
• Network performance management of 2G/3G/4G/5G/ NBIoT RAN.
• Perform KPI monitoring, root cause analysis, and performance tuning of radio networks.
• Collaborate with RF engineers for coverage and capacity planning.
• Troubleshoot site-level and cluster-level RAN issues (call drops, interference, handover failures).
• Support in Pre-post analysis for any new site integration, software upgrades, and feature implementation.
• Network performance management of Core domain (CS/PS/VAS), EPC/5GC components: MME, SGW, PGW, AMF, SMF, etc.
• KPI analysis and troubleshooting.
• Troubleshoot signalling and bearer path issues using protocols like GTP, Diameter, SCTP, SIP.
• Analyze call flows, CDRs, and trace logs for issue resolution.
• Support in Pre-post analysis for any new site integration, software upgrades, and feature implementation.
• Work with vendors for core software upgrades and capacity expansion.
